Man dies after Leroy Street fire

A man has died in hospital following a fire at a flat in Leroy Street on Saturday 29 December.

Two fire engines and around ten firefighters from Old Kent Road Fire Station fought the blaze, which started in the kitchen of the four-roomed flat near the Bricklayers Arms roundabout.

Firefighters rescued the man from the kitchen and he was taken to hospital suffering from smoke inhalation and burns.

The London Fire Brigade was called to Leroy Street just after 1.30pm and the fire was under control by 2.30pm. Around a quarter of the flat was damaged by the blaze.

The cause of the fire is under investigation.
